Addiction does not only effect the addict. Actually, the consequences for family and friends are typically also worse. Lots of enjoyed ones believe that as soon as the addict leaves the treatment center, everything will swiftly improve. Nevertheless, recuperation is a long-lasting procedure, for both the addict and also every person in their lives.

Dependency places a major stress on all of an addict or alcoholic's personal partnerships, as well as the closer the partnership, the higher the pressure. As the addiction expands stronger in time, it progressively pertains to control every element of the addict's life, particularly their relationships. At some point, every interaction between loved ones and the addict become affected by their addiction in some manner.

Family and friends typically aim to persuade their enjoyed one for months, and even years, to participate in rehab. Rehab becomes a sort of magic remedy all. Many concerned really hope or think that as soon as their loved one returns from rehabilitation, all of the problems in their connection will significantly and also immediately boost. While rehabilitation is absolutely an absolutely important initial step in healing, it doesn't fix every problem, and it can in fact develop brand-new challenges and also difficulties.

The truth is that recovery is a lifelong process that drastically alters points for somebody in recovery on a day-to-day, if not moment-to-moment, basis. Usually, recovery will certainly change a person's objectives, assumptions, behavior, or even individuality. Subsequently, this could trigger changes in loved ones and relationships. It could additionally compel two people to face underlying concerns that were lengthy covered up by addiction.

Dependency creates several long lasting problems, both for addicts and their loved ones. While sobriety will certainly boost all them, several will still be present during recovery. Financial problems are common, especially as the recouping addict aims to restore their career and also repay addiction relevant financial debts such as DUI expenditures. Health issue brought on by dependency are a few of one of the most serious, as well as some, such as HIV, are irreversible.

Partnership troubles can be one of the most painful; it could take years to rebuild trust fund, and in many cases, it just isn't possible. Additionally, relapse is always an opportunity, after several years. Recognizing and also planning for these troubles will certainly make it less complicated to handle them as well as decrease their impact.

The assistance of loved ones is frequently important to a recovering addict preserving their sobriety, particularly in the initial months after rehab.

Among the most significant root causes of relapse is tension. The danger is often best in the very first months after rehabilitation as the recuperating addict adapts to life without the escape of substances. While life outside of a treatment center inherently includes a great deal of anxiety, as well as it can not be completely gotten rid of. Nevertheless, it can be significantly decreased.

In circumstances where the stress is naturally existing, tension relief strategies can be utilized.

Among the greatest issues with enablers is that they set limits, yet then let their addicted addict violate them. This lets the addict think that the limit setter is not significant as well as not a person to be valued. In the future, they will certainly disregard any borders, and also typically that person entirely. That's why it is vital to not only explain, strong borders of what is and also just what is not acceptable, yet additionally to strongly impose them.

There might be some initial anger as well as anger, but in time the recouping addict will certainly come to respect and be grateful to their enjoyed one.

Sadly, relapses occur, and with terrific regularity. Several researches recommend that most of recouping addicts will at some point regression eventually in their lives. However, even if a relapse occurs, it does not imply that a person's long-lasting soberness is at risk. With mindful as well as rapid interest, a regression could be restricted as well as had.
